Witamy w naszym artykule, w którym omówimy klucz tabeli i jego znaczenie. Jeśli jesteś zainteresowany tematem baz danych i chcesz dowiedzieć się więcej o kluczach tabeli, to jesteś we właściwym miejscu!
Czym jest klucz tabeli?
Klucz tabeli to kolumna lub zestaw kolumn w bazie danych, które służą do jednoznacznego identyfikowania rekordów w tabeli. Klucz tabeli jest niezwykle ważny, ponieważ umożliwia nam skuteczne zarządzanie danymi i zapewnia integralność danych w bazie.
Klucz tabeli może mieć różne typy, takie jak:
- Klucz główny (Primary Key): Jest to unikalny identyfikator dla każdego rekordu w tabeli. Klucz główny jest niezwykle istotny, ponieważ zapewnia unikalność danych i umożliwia szybkie wyszukiwanie i sortowanie.
- Klucz obcy (Foreign Key): Jest to kolumna w tabeli, która odwołuje się do klucza głównego w innej tabeli. Klucz obcy umożliwia nam tworzenie relacji między tabelami i zapewnia spójność danych.
- Klucz kandydujący (Candidate Key): Jest to kolumna lub zestaw kolumn, które mogą służyć jako klucz główny, ale nie są jeszcze wybrane jako główny klucz tabeli.
Znaczenie klucza tabeli
Klucz tabeli jest niezwykle istotny w projektowaniu baz danych i ma wiele korzyści, takich jak:
- Unikalność danych: Klucz główny zapewnia, że każdy rekord w tabeli jest unikalny. Dzięki temu możemy uniknąć duplikatów danych i utrzymać integralność danych.
- Wyszukiwanie i sortowanie: Klucz tabeli umożliwia szybkie wyszukiwanie i sortowanie danych. Dzięki temu możemy efektywnie odnajdywać potrzebne informacje w bazie danych.
- Tworzenie relacji: Klucz obcy umożliwia nam tworzenie relacji między tabelami. Dzięki temu możemy łączyć dane z różnych tabel i tworzyć bardziej zaawansowane zapytania.
- Integrowanie danych: Klucz tabeli zapewnia spójność danych w bazie. Dzięki temu możemy uniknąć sytuacji, w których dane są niezgodne lub niekompletne.
Jak używać klucza tabeli?
Aby skutecznie korzystać z klucza tabeli, musimy pamiętać o kilku ważnych zasadach:
- Unikalność: Klucz główny powinien być unikalny dla każdego rekordu w tabeli. Nie możemy mieć dwóch rekordów z tym samym kluczem głównym.
- Integralność: Klucz obcy powinien odwoływać się do istniejącego klucza głównego w innej tabeli. Dzięki temu możemy utrzymać spójność danych.
- Indeksowanie: Klucz tabeli powinien być zindeksowany, aby umożliwić szybkie wyszukiwanie i sortowanie danych. Indeksowanie poprawia wydajność bazy danych.
Podsumowanie
Klucz tabeli jest niezwykle ważnym elementem w projektowaniu baz danych. Zapewnia unikalność danych, umożliwia efektywne wyszukiwanie i sortowanie, tworzy relacje między tabelami i zapewnia integralność danych. Pamiętaj o zasadach używania klucza tabeli, takich jak unikalność, integralność i indeksowanie, aby skutecznie zarządzać danymi w bazie.
Mamy nadzieję, że ten artykuł dostarczył Ci wartościowych informacji na temat klucza tabeli. Jeśli masz jakiekolwiek pytania lub chciałbyś się podzielić swoimi doświadczeniami z kluczami tabeli, daj nam znać w komentarzach poniżej!
Dziękujemy za przeczytanie!
Wezwanie do działania:
Zapoznaj się z pojęciem „klucz tabeli” i dowiedz się, jakie jest jego znaczenie w kontekście baz danych. Zdobądź wiedzę na ten temat, odwiedzając stronę https://www.naukaibiznes.pl/.